## Component Library Versioning

Welcome aboard. Brickline, our shared component library, follows strict semver. Pin exact versions; never use ranges. Breaking changes ship only in majors, announced a sprint ahead. To pull packages from the internal registry, configure your local client with the key below.

service key, taguf-faduf: qvz7-ll4b4Pk

Handover note — Pagination in the Coralbeam public API

For the security review: Coralbeam's REST API uses opaque cursor tokens rather than offsets, which prevents enumeration of internal row IDs. Cursors are signed and expire after a fixed window; Hadley added rotation for the signing secret last quarter. Rate limits apply per token, not per IP. Please audit the token lifetime and page-size caps against the values listed below.

service settings:
PRAWYN_PIN=9848
PRAWYN_METRICS_HOST=metrics.prawyn.lumicworks.corp
PRAWYN_LOG_LEVEL=warn
PRAWYN_TENANT=pelius

Q3 Planning Note — Varnholt Systems

Board: deal desk approvals above 15% discount remain concentrated in three reps. Margin erosion on large Corvex-line deals hit 4.2 points this quarter. Proposal: hard cap at 18%, CFO sign-off above 12%, volume commitments required in writing. Rollout begins next quarter pending board assent. Expected margin recovery: 2 points by year-end. The confidential rationale tied to next year's plan follows below.

internal memo for kawip-hadug: Headcount on the Wenwyn team goes from 7 to 140 by the end of January. Gross margin on Wenwyn came in at 20 percent against a plan of 15 percent.

# FuelTally Environments

Welcome aboard! FuelTally generates the weekly fuel-usage report for the Harkwell delivery fleet. There are two environments: sandbox (fake fleet data, safe to break) and live (real depot feeds, please don't break). Most of your work happens in sandbox — the report job runs nightly there so you can see your changes by morning. Sandbox runs with the settings below.

settings of yahaf-tahop:
jorox:
  pin: 5851
  tenant: noveth
  seal: seal_7ddb5c42
  metrics_host: metrics.jorox.ordinnet.example
  standby_team: wenax
  escalation: oliath-feneth
  nonce: 552548